Infrared thermography for normal endothelial function screening.

Summary

Thermography can screen for normal endothelial function in adults with cardiovascular risk factors. A palmar region temperature of ≥ 36 °C after one minute of ischemia indicates healthy endothelial function.

Area of Science:

  • Cardiovascular Medicine
  • Diagnostic Imaging
  • Vascular Biology

Background:

  • Endothelial dysfunction (ED) is a precursor to accelerated atherosclerosis and premature death.
  • Early detection of ED is crucial for cardiovascular risk management.
  • Screening methods for ED need to be accessible and non-invasive.

Purpose of the Study:

  • To evaluate the utility of infrared thermography for screening endothelial function.
  • To assess thermography's effectiveness in adults with cardiovascular risk factors.

Main Methods:

  • Cross-sectional diagnostic test study.
  • Endothelial function assessed by brachial arterial diameter changes post-ischemia and nitroglycerin.
  • Palmar thermography performed one minute after ischemia.

Main Results:

  • The study included 38 subjects (median age 50 years).
  • A palmar temperature cutoff of ≥ 36 °C at one minute post-ischemia showed 85% sensitivity and 70% specificity for normal endothelial function.
  • Area under the ROC curve was 0.796.

Conclusions:

  • Infrared thermography is a practical, non-invasive, and inexpensive tool for screening endothelial function.
  • A palmar temperature ≥ 36 °C after one minute of ischemia suggests normal endothelial function in at-risk adults.
  • Thermography offers a viable screening method for cardiovascular risk assessment.
